How loud are you? Go to a competition and put it on the meter. Your quite possibly in the low 140's or high 130's assuming you have done no treatments to the vehicle and have just slapped it in the trunk. There is no reason a single 15" cant get to the high 140's and touch 150 db but it has to be the right car and the right setup for that car. Yes the car is a major part of the equation
Ask your questions to the loud guys at the competition (like Yuli BTW) and they will help you out too. It is a little early to be worried about phasing and port length, but it is time to start considering box sizes and shapes, then ports come into play once you go with a large or small box... I am pretty sure you do not know your hot frequency yet but 40Hz is mighty low.
